Title:
Hinge for door with shock absorber

Abstract:
A slow-closing door hinge, includes a first foldout (1) and a second foldout (2) having a shaft sleeve respectively. A fixed rod (3) is fixedly mounted in the shaft sleeve of the first foldout (1), and a rotating rod (5) is fixedly mounted in the shaft sleeve of the second foldout (2). A connecting rod (4) connects the fixed rod (3) and the rotating rod (5). The connecting rod (4) and the fixed rod (3) are movably connected, and a hollow groove (46) is provided at the joint. A restoring spring (45) in contact with the fixed rod (3) and fixed to the connecting rod (4) is provided in the hollow groove (46). The connecting rod (4) is connected with the rotating rod (5) in a coaxial, rotationally actuating manner. The relative forward and backward rotation of the fixed rod (3) and the rotating rod (5) cooperates with the restoring spring (45) to drive the connecting rod (4) in a reciprocal motion within the shaft sleeve. The slow-closing door hinge has a simple structure, is easy to install, and can avoid the loss of slow-closing function when a malfunction occurs.
